Output 0abe18d27a6ceb51d6215f5ad46fc573a32f99b6a44b32a40e690c90ed623ab2:1

value
3600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db173e3670c98c6c4fc2c780ef3bc30ffd964b8 OP_EQUAL
address
3EcDnDm2rjwFKNnLZL55TXAqXaXtUaVS7e
transaction
0abe18d27a6ceb51d6215f5ad46fc573a32f99b6a44b32a40e690c90ed623ab2
confirmations
374705
spent
true